For the time being I am really fed up with trying to reset LK, LLK and LM.
It is not a matter of technique applied because I managed to reset 6 carts and the maintenance kit.
I stopped sending money to some obscure unknown Chinese companies of the Alibaba clan!

Perhaps somebody, with a resetter that works perfectly well, will be kind enough to send me this device just for resetting after which I will return same, by DHL well packed.
It goes without saying that I will pay for all courier service costs of the kind sender.
If I then still could not reset my chips, this must then be caused by these specific LK, LLK and LM carts.
I plan then the purchase of new original OEM carts LK, LLK and LM, and reset these.
I wonder whether there could be a reason why it still would not be possible to reset these new carts?

For the time being I am printing with 7 refill carts and with the OEM Epson M-cart, which I modified (system jtoolman) and refilled.
I did not replace the OEM Matte cart, which I could reset but which is unused and full.
